Ms Maleeha Mughal is a distinguished consultant plastic surgeon based in London, who stands at the forefront of her field, specialising in a range of transformative procedures. Her expertise spans breast augmentation, head and neck surgery, breast reduction, lymphoedema management and abdominoplasty (tummy tuck), in addition to her exceptional proficiency in breast reconstruction.
Ms Mughal commenced her medical journey with an MBBS degree from the University of Health Sciences Lahore, Pakistan in 2005. After undertaking her basic plastic surgery training, she spent a year in Canada where she specialised in complex microvascular reconstruction working at Toronto general hospital, Mount Sinai Hospital and Princess Margaret Cancer Centre. She was later awarded the esteemed FRCS qualification and earned a masters in burns, plastic, and reconstructive surgery from University College London.
Ms Mughal’s dedication to cancer treatment led her to undergo advanced training in supermicrosurgery procedures, enhancing her ability to manage cancer-related lymphoedema. She further honed her skills through a microsurgical fellowship at Guy's & St. Thomas Hospital, where she gained expertise in intricate soft tissue reconstruction of the chest wall, abdomen, and perineum. Additionally, she was awarded the prestigious London Clinic Aesthetic Surgery Fellowship.
Beyond her clinical practice, Ms Mughal is a prolific researcher with a portfolio of over 40 articles published in peer-reviewed journals, as well as authoring chapters in the prestigious Oxford Textbook of Plastic Surgery. Her dedication to advancing the field of plastic surgery through research and her commitment to patient care make Ms Mughal a renowned figure in the world of plastic surgery.
